Rhoda Blanche Jones, 86, of Leading Ck., died Wednesday, Oct. 31. 2001 at her home. She was born on Yellow Ck., the daughter of the late Arthur Bailey Doc Richards and Indiana Taylor Richards. She was a housewife. Surviving are four daughter, Shirley Taylor and her husband Douglas and Betty Jenkins and husband Eddie, all of Big Bend, Wanda Dye and husband Keith of Midland, NC, and Carol Ritchie and husband Thomas of Hawkinsville, Ga,; three sons, Darl Jones and wife Carol of Statesville, NC, Russell Jones and wife Vicki of Big Springs, and Donald Welch and wife Lula of Macon, Ga., one daughter in law Fumiko Welch of Mt. Zion; 19 grandchildren;one step grandchild; 20 great grandchildren, and two step great grandchildren. She was preceded in death by her first husband, Robert Welch; her second husband, Harley Jones, April 28, 2001; one son, William F. Bill Welch; two grandaugher, including Debra Taylor Fowler; six sisters, Minnie Eagle, Eliza Jane Wilson, Dessie Goodnight, and Alma, Thelma, and Opal, who died in infancy, and five brothers, Willard and Lester Richards, and Oakie, Carl and Kenneth wo died in infancy. She was the last surviving member of her immediate family, Services were held at Stump Furneal Home, Grantsville, with Rev. Larry Jones officiating. Burial was in the Goodnight Cem., Big Bend
